What Pete says is correct about the headlamps being set up for left hand drive. The other thing is, the USA aren't so fussy on headlamps as we are, the dipped and main beam patterns are almost the same, just with the main beam being higher. Instead of having the kick-up on the passenger side as we do (and so do the EU but the passenger side is the other side) they have a slightly larger area on the passenger side : You know how when you drive on dipped beam, you can still see the road signs, nice and bright? That's courtesy of the kick-up which should also show you pedestrians, animals etc on the pavement/verge etc. You may be able to use the housings they supply if you get the right size correct dipping headlamps for the UK (confusingly known as Left Hand Dip and often marked "LHD") so you could use the housings. Stu (aka Hughezee) has the USA spec rear lights as i recall that are basically red across the whole lens area with an orange LED indicator bullb to improve the colour and overall light output of the red lens. The big problem in this country with lighting is the Destruction & Abuse (better known as Construction & Use) regulations tend to be somewhat strict so there's not a wild amount you can do to personalise them.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
